Structural Drying Process
The drying process involves using specialized equipment to remove moisture from your property. Our team uses a combination of air movers, dehumidifiers, and moisture meters to monitor the drying process. The goal is to dry your property within 3-5 days to prevent mold growth and structural damage.

Emergency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small sink overflow on tile floor | Yes | No | A small spill can be handled with a wet/dry vacuum and some elbow grease. |
| Flooded basement with standing water | No | Yes | Standing water can hide hidden mold and structural damage, needing professional help. |
| Wet drywall behind cabinets | No | Yes | Hidden moisture behind drywall can cause mold growth and structural damage, needing professional help. |
